Luo Brothers Biography

Weidong Luo, Guangxi Autonomous Region (China), 1963

Weiguo Luo, Guangxi Autonomous Region (China), 1964

Weibing Luo, Guangxi Autonomous Region (China), 1972

Beijing-based artists The Luo Brothers are responsible for some of China's most provocative and renowned contemporary art and their work has been instrumental in establishing major trends in Chinese art such as the 'Political Pop' and 'Gaudy Art' movements. They are stylistically aligned with a 'pop' sensibility, charged by political fervour and informed by generations of local traditional craft-making techniques. They have created some of the best known and provocative contemporary Chinese works.
